Understanding PSA: A Prostate Health Marker
Prostate-Specific Antigen, or PSA, is a protein produced by cells in the prostate gland, a small gland located below the bladder in men. A small amount of PSA circulates in the blood, and its levels can be measured with a simple blood test.
This test serves as a screening tool for prostate health, primarily to detect potential issues like benign prostatic hyperplasia (BPH), prostatitis (inflammation of the prostate), or prostate cancer. Elevated PSA levels prompt further investigation, but they do not definitively diagnose any specific condition.
Several factors can influence PSA readings, including age, prostate size, certain medical procedures, and even specific medications. It is a marker that provides a snapshot of prostate activity, not a standalone diagnostic indicator.
Can Caffeine Affect PSA Levels? Examining the Evidence
The question of whether caffeine directly impacts PSA levels has been a subject of scientific inquiry. Research on this topic generally points to a consistent finding: moderate caffeine intake does not appear to significantly alter PSA measurements.
Numerous studies have investigated the relationship between coffee, tea, and other caffeinated beverages and PSA levels. These studies often observe large populations over extended periods, tracking dietary habits and health outcomes.
A significant body of evidence suggests no direct causal link where caffeine itself causes a measurable rise or fall in PSA. For instance, large cohort studies have not found a correlation between daily coffee consumption and an increased risk of elevated PSA or prostate cancer detection.
Some early research explored the possibility, but later, more robust studies have largely concluded that caffeine is not a key variable in PSA fluctuations. This means that for most individuals, enjoying their regular caffeinated beverage is unlikely to skew their PSA test results.
The Role of Coffee Compounds Beyond Caffeine
Coffee, a primary source of caffeine for many, contains a complex mix of bioactive compounds beyond just caffeine. These include antioxidants like chlorogenic acids, diterpenes such as cafestol and kahweol, and various polyphenols.
These compounds exhibit a range of biological activities, including anti-inflammatory and antioxidant properties. Some research has explored whether these other components of coffee might influence prostate health or PSA levels, independent of caffeine.
While some studies suggest potential benefits of coffee consumption for overall health, including a possible reduced risk of certain chronic conditions, a direct, consistent impact on PSA levels attributable to these non-caffeine compounds has not been established. The overall dietary pattern holds more weight than single compounds.
Dietary Factors Influencing PSA Readings
While caffeine appears to have little direct impact, other dietary and lifestyle factors can influence PSA levels, or at least how they are interpreted. Understanding these can help individuals prepare for a PSA test and discuss results with their healthcare provider.
Some supplements, for example, have been noted to potentially affect PSA. Saw palmetto, a common herbal supplement for prostate health, has been shown in some studies to lower PSA levels. It is important to disclose all supplements to a doctor before any blood test.
Dietary fat intake has also been a subject of interest. A diet rich in saturated fat has been linked to various health concerns, but its direct, consistent impact on PSA levels is not definitively established. A balanced diet, rich in fruits, vegetables, and whole grains, supports overall cellular health, including prostate tissue. The National Institutes of Health (NIH) highlights that a healthy diet, rich in fruits and vegetables, contributes to overall cellular health, including prostate tissue.
Just as specific foods affect blood sugar or cholesterol, certain dietary choices can influence the body’s systems. However, the influence on PSA is often indirect or not as pronounced as other factors.
| Factor | Potential Influence | Notes |
|---|---|---|
| Saw Palmetto | May lower PSA | Discuss supplement use with a doctor before testing. |
| High Saturated Fat Diet | Mixed findings on direct PSA impact | Generally linked to overall health concerns. |
| Lycopene (e.g., cooked tomatoes) | Antioxidant benefits for prostate | No direct PSA lowering effect established. |
| Soy Products | Some studies suggest minor effects | Not a consistent or significant PSA influencer. |

Interpreting Your PSA Results
Understanding PSA results requires careful discussion with a healthcare provider. A PSA test is a screening tool, not a definitive diagnosis of prostate cancer. Many factors, both benign and serious, can cause PSA levels to rise.
Temporary elevations can occur due to recent ejaculation, vigorous exercise, prostate inflammation (prostatitis), or a urinary tract infection. Medical procedures involving the prostate, such as a biopsy or catheterization, can also significantly increase PSA readings for a period.
It is important to provide a complete medical history and discuss any recent activities or symptoms with your doctor. They can interpret your PSA level in the context of your age, overall health, and other risk factors, guiding any subsequent steps or further tests.
| Factor | Effect on PSA | Duration of Effect |
|---|---|---|
| Ejaculation | Short-term, minor rise | Returns to baseline within 24-48 hours. |
| Prostate Biopsy | Significant, prolonged rise | Can remain elevated for weeks to months. |
| Urinary Tract Infection (UTI) | Can elevate PSA | Resolves once the infection is treated. |
| Prostatitis (Prostate Inflammation) | Can cause significant elevation | Depends on the duration and severity of inflammation. |
| Vigorous Exercise (e.g., cycling) | Temporary, minor rise | Returns to baseline within a few days. |
